Output 7d9358a89ded52a0e7feb53b0a57c234126154ddaf3773683d6fd2a83b618458:7

value
130542300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61fba503ccf3ccc496b09636d1dd3be3d78eebf7 OP_EQUAL
address
MGqFEcMPH6bVDgwzmgX3aUyoVjUiVjuag8
transaction
7d9358a89ded52a0e7feb53b0a57c234126154ddaf3773683d6fd2a83b618458
spent
true